Applicable Regulations: <br /> Section 17-6.10 RESIDENTIAL-GOLF COURSE COMMUNITY OVERLAY <br /> DISTRICT (RG) <br /> 1. Purpose and Intent. The purpose of the Residential-Golf Course <br /> Community <br /> Overlay District(RG)is to permit developments that will be enhanced by <br /> coordinated area site planning, diversified location of structures and/or mixing <br /> of compatible uses such as single/multi-family residential units and golf <br /> course uses. Such developments are intended to provide a safe and efficient <br /> system for pedestrian and vehicle traffic;to provide attractive recreation and <br /> open space as integral parts of the developments; to enable economic design <br /> in the location of public and private utilities and community facilities; and to <br /> ensure adequate standards of construction and planning. The Residential-Golf <br /> Course Community Overlay District will allow for flexibility of overall <br /> development design with benefits from such design flexibility intended to be <br /> derived by both the developer and the community. <br /> 2. Permitted Uses. <br /> A. Dwelling,Multi-Family <br /> B. Dwelling, Single-Family <br /> C. Golf Course <br /> 3. Minimum Lot Size. The minimum lot size required for the establishment <br /> of Residential-Golf Course Community as defined by this overlay district <br /> is five acres. <br /> 4. Density. Within the overlay district, for the development of a Residential- <br /> Golf Course Community,the maximum density shall be two units per <br /> buildable acre. <br /> 5. Setbacks and Impervious Surface Coverage Requirements. All setbacks <br /> and impervious surface coverage requirements of the underlying zoning <br /> district shall apply with the exception on the following: <br /> A. Side yard setback: 10 feet <br /> B. Maximum Impervious Surface Coverage: 20% <br /> 6. Procedural Requirements. Any development in the Residential Golf <br /> Course Community Overlay District shall be permitted as planned unit <br /> development(PUD).
